Warmer Thoughts
Cast forward to those first days where half clad trees coax memories of freshness though you’ve stepped out wrapped still in winter blues, insistent sun and boisterous green beguile you to disrobe and give skin to this welcome discomfort at being over-encumbered as the new season embraces, the shedding can begin
